PHP.SU

Программирование на PHP, MySQL и другие веб-технологии
PHP.SU Портал     На главную страницу форума Главная     Помощь Помощь     Поиск Поиск     Поиск Яндекс Поиск Яндекс     Вакансии  Пользователи Пользователи

Страниц (1): [1]

> Найдено сообщений: 1
mellem Отправлено: 19 Сентября, 2006 - 14:36:40 • Тема: Поиск по MySql • Форум: Работа с СУБД

Ответов: 4
Просмотров: 3964
Помогите кто уже делал чтото подобное

из файла find.php

CODE (text):
скопировать код в буфер обмена
  1.  
  2. <?php
  3. include 'c.php';
  4. echo head("&#207;&#238;&#232;&#241;&#234;");
  5. echo lpanel();
  6.  
  7. $findit=$_POST['find'];
  8. $in=$_POST['in'];
  9. if($find) {
  10.  if($in=='catalog') {
  11.    $q="select id, name, text, pic from catalog";
  12.    $q=mysql_query($q) or die(me(mysql_error()));
  13.    while($r=mysql_fetch_assoc($q)) if(stristr($r['name'], $find) or stristr($r['title'], $find)) catalog($r['id'], $r['name'], $r['text'], $r['pic'], $find);
  14.  
  15.  } elseif($in=='site') {
  16.    $q="select id, title, text from content";
  17.    $q=mysql_query($q) or die(me(mysql_error()));
  18.    while($r=mysql_fetch_assoc($q)) if(stristr($r['text'], $find)) echo "<a href='pages.php?page={$r['id']}'>{$r['title']}</a>
  19.           ";
  20.  
  21. }
  22. } else {
  23. echo "
  24.  
  25. <form action='find.php' method='post'>
  26. &#207;&#238;&#232;&#241;&#234; &#239;&#238;:
  27. <input type='radio' name='in' value='site' /> &#241;&#224;&#233;&#242;
  28. <input type='radio' name='in' value='catalog' /> &#234;&#224;&#242;&#224;&#235;&#238;&#227;
  29. <input style='width: 100%;' type='text' name='find' value='' />
  30. <input type='submit' name='find' value='&#200;&#241;&#234;&#224;&#242;&#252;' />
  31. </form>
  32. ";
  33. }
  34. echo fin();
  35. ?>
  36.  


Суть такая форма с возможностью поиска по сайту и по коталогу

вот чтото не пашет тока Огорчение


Страниц (1): [1]
Powered by PHP  Powered By MySQL  Powered by Nginx  Valid CSS  RSS

 
Powered by ExBB FM 1.0 RC1. InvisionExBB